This March 21 and where in the world will yellow flowers be given?

Mexican Internet users are the main promoters of an initiative that has been popular for years and is associated with the arrival of spring and the details of gift-giving. Yellow flowers In direct connection to the person you love the most with a hit song of the Argentine pop genre that captivated the youth of the beginning of the 21st century.

Between 2004 and 2005, “Florissenta” A youth soap opera of Argentinian origin produced by Cris Morena that appealed to all ages, a few years later, it became a trend again, but not with the performances of Florencia Bertotti, Juan Gil Navarro or Fabio Di Tomaso. .

Using the chorus of the song “Flores Amarillas” from the romantic comedy's soundtrack, Mexican Tik Tok users go viral and start trending on social networks, requesting each year to deliver roses or bouquets of the protagonist's favorite color. . What does the yellow flower represent and what are its characteristics?

This March 21, hundreds if not thousands of women, mostly in Mexico, will be waiting for spring with open arms to receive the yellow flowers they love.

The striking color represents friendship at its best, while being characterized by radiating optimism and energy.

Likewise, the yellow flower is perfect for decorating your living room or other space in the house because it provides light and beauty.
